Key Storylines
Recent Form
Carolina has opened the season strongly at 7‑3‑0 and has won a number of high‑scoring affairs. They are averaging 3.90 goals per game while conceding 3.00 goals per game. Their power‑play has been a weak point, with a 9.7% conversion rate. They will try to improve that number to get another win on the road today. Boston comes into this game with a 6‑7‑0 record and they have won two games in a row coming into this contest. The Bruins average 3.31 goals per game and give up more than that at 3.62 goals per game.
Goaltending
Goaltending remains a question mark for both squads. Both teams have starting goaltenders with GAAs above 3.00 for the season so far. Frederik Andersen and Jeremy Swayman both need to step up if their teams are going to come up with a win in this important Eastern Conference game.
Key Skaters
Carolina’s Sebastian Aho has four goals and seven assists through 10 games. Aho will be central to Carolina’s attack in this game as he is in every game. Boston forward Morgan Geekie has had a hot start with nine goals and two assists in 13 games. David Pastrnak leads the Bruins with 10 assists.
